Am I legally required to notify my neighbor before replacing a shared fence?

Yes. Under Colorado Revised Statutes 35-46-112, you must provide written notice to adjoining landowners before construction, repair, or replacement of a partition fence. This 'good neighbor law' is a specific legal requirement in Perry Park for any shared boundary work.

Is my fence engineered for high winds?

A proper fence design accounts for the 115 MPH V-ult wind speed rating. This engineering standard dictates post spacing, concrete footing size, and bracket strength. Fences not designed to ASCE 7-22 standards for this wind load will likely fail during our peak storm season gusts.

How deep do fence posts need to be in Perry Park to prevent heaving?

Posts require a 36-inch footing depth to be below the local frost line. Following IRC standards, posts set shallower than this in Perry Park Ranch will experience frost heave, which destabilizes the entire structure. This depth is non-negotiable for long-term stability.

What are the critical steps before digging fence post holes?

You must call Colorado 811 for utility locates at least three business days before excavation. Hitting a gas, fiber, or power line in Perry Park Ranch is a major liability and safety hazard. What are the height and setback rules for fences in Perry Park?

Zoning limits are 4 feet in front yards and 6 feet in rear/side yards. The setback is 0 feet, allowing construction on the property line. Corner lots must maintain clear visibility 'sight triangles' at intersections; this is critical for safety near high-traffic corridors like I-25.

How does Perry Park's soil affect my fence material choice?

The moderate soil corrosivity index and slight to moderate termite risk dictate material compatibility. Use pressure-treated wood rated for ground contact or corrosion-resistant metals. All fasteners must be hot-dip galvanized or stainless steel to prevent rust streaks and premature failure.
